Rancher juan wants to enclose a rectangular area beside a river. there are 240 yards of fencing available. what is the largest t

otal area that can be enclosed?

Perimeter = 2L + 2W →  240 = 2L + 2W  →  120 = L + W  → 120-L = W
Area = L x W  → Area = L(120-L)  →  Area = 120L - L²
Find the derivative:
dA/dL = 120 -2L → 0 = 120 - 2L → L = 60

Area = 120L - L² = 120(60) - (60)²  = 7200 - 3600 = 3600

The maximum area is 3600 yds²
